Annual Charity Ball of Cedar Foundation

Each year, the team of one of the largest NGOs in Bulgaria – the Cedar Foundation, organizes a Charity Ball, which aims to support disadvantaged children and young adults.

This year’s edition of the ball has a theme “Once Upon a Time…”, and will be held on November 24th at Sofia Event Center. The organizers of the event expect 200 guests, including foreign partners, business representatives, diplomats and public figures. The attendees will enjoy an interesting music program, a live auction and a charity raffle.

The auction is once again entrusted to Preslava Fentham-Fletcher

Preslava is a professional Christies’ trained auctioneer. With her extensive experience in conducting auctions, she is traveling again from London to Sofia especially for the event. This year’s live auction will feature collectible items and exciting experiences, including paintings by Bulgarian artists, a tennis ball signed by Grigor Dimitrov and access to the VIP Lodge of Bulgaria Hall.

Trio HYPNOTIC and Yana Doynova will be part of the music program

HYPNOTIC trio – one of the most successful string formations in our country will once again open the Once Upon a Time Charity Ball. Under the sounds of viola, violin and cello, the guests will enjoy some of their most iconic performances.

Yana Doynova will carry you over to the magic of a fairy tale instrument – the harp. The young harpist uses her instrument not only to create art, but also to connect with people and help them. She also provides free lessons for children with disabilities, and believes that this is a way for them to cope with difficulties and feel better.

With the special participation of Balkanski Circus

For the first year, artists from the Balkanski Circus will take part in the Cedar Foundation’s Ball. They will impress the guests with an equilibrium performance created especially for the event.
